Abstract

A snowthrower includes a shaft configured to rotate around a first axis, a first auger connected to the shaft, an intake housing configured to receive at least a portion of the shaft, and a scraping assembly mounted to the intake housing. The scraping assembly includes a bottom edge disposed frontward of the first axis.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A snowthrower, comprising:
 a shaft configured to rotate around a first axis, wherein a first auger is connected to the shaft;   an intake housing configured to receive at least a portion of the shaft; and   a scraping assembly mounted to the intake housing;   wherein the scraping assembly comprises a bottom edge disposed frontward of the first axis.   
     
     
         2 . The snowthrower of  claim 1 , wherein the intake housing has a first sidewall and a second sidewall opposite the first sidewall, the first sidewall and the second sidewall together substantially define a front end and a rear end of the intake housing. 
     
     
         3 . The snowthrower of  claim 2 , wherein the first sidewall has a first front edge, the second sidewall has a second front edge, at least a portion of the first front edge and at least a portion of the second front edge slopes rearward to an upper portion of the intake housing. 
     
     
         4 . The snowthrower of  claim 2 , wherein the scraping assembly is mounted to the intake housing along a second axis, a ratio of a front-rear distance from the front end to the second axis to a front-rear distance from the front end to the rear end is greater than or equal to 0 and smaller than or equal to 0.5. 
     
     
         5 . The snowthrower of  claim 4 , wherein the scraping assembly is fixedly mounted to the intake housing with a first fastening member and a second fastening member, and the first fastening member and the second fastening member are disposed along the second axis. 
     
     
         6 . The snowthrower of  claim 2 , wherein a front-rear distance from the bottom edge to the rear end is longer than a front-rear distance from the first axis to the rear end. 
     
     
         7 . The snowthrower of  claim 2 , wherein a front-rear distance from the bottom edge to the front end is shorter than a front-rear distance from the first axis to the front end. 
     
     
         8 . The snowthrower of  claim 1 , wherein the scraping assembly comprises a scraping surface forming an angle greater than or equal to 0 degrees and smaller than or equal to 30 degrees to the ground. 
     
     
         9 . The snowthrower of  claim 1 , wherein the scraping assembly comprises an integrated scraping board. 
     
     
         10 . The snowthrower of  claim 1 , wherein the first auger has a first outer edge, and the first outer edge is configured to contact the snow before the intake housing contacts the snow. 
     
     
         11 . The snowthrower of  claim 10 , wherein a second auger is connected to the shaft, the first auger and the second auger are arranged on the shaft along different axial positions, the second auger has a second outer edge, and the second outer edge is configured to contact the snow before the intake housing contacts the snow. 
     
     
         12 . The snowthrower of  claim 1 , wherein the snowthrower comprises a support assembly connected to the intake housing, the support assembly is configured to elevate the intake housing from the ground and to contact the ground with a first material or a second material selectively. 
     
     
         13 . The snowthrower of  claim 12 , wherein the support assembly has a supporting state and a storing state, when the support assembly is in the supporting state, the first material is selected to contact with the ground, when the support assembly is in the storing state, the second material is selected to contact with the ground. 
     
     
         14 . The snowthrower of  claim 12 , wherein the first material is a metal material, and the second material is a plastic material. 
     
     
         15 . The snowthrower of  claim 12 , wherein at least a portion of the support assembly is movably connected to intake housing. 
     
     
         16 . A snowthrower, comprising:
 a shaft configured to rotate around an axis, wherein a first auger is connected to the shaft;   an intake housing configured to receive at least a portion of the shaft;   a scraping assembly mounted to the intake housing; and   an enclosure with a center of gravity consisting of the shaft, the first auger, the intake housing, and the scraping assembly;   wherein the first auger has a first inner edge defining a first inner circumference, the center of gravity is located within the first inner circumference, the scraping assembly comprises a bottom edge disposed frontward of the center of gravity.   
     
     
         17 . A snowthrower, comprising:
 a shaft configured to rotate around a first axis, wherein a first auger is connected to the shaft;   an intake housing configured to receive at least a portion of the shaft;   a wheel assembly configured to rotate around a wheel axis; and   a scraping assembly mounted to the intake housing;   wherein the scraping assembly comprises a bottom edge, and a ratio of a front-rear distance from the bottom edge to the wheel axis to a front-rear distance from the first axis to the wheel axis is greater than or equal to 1 and smaller than or equal to 1.5.   
     
     
         18 . The snowthrower of  claim 17 , wherein the intake housing has a first sidewall and a second sidewall opposite the first sidewall, the first sidewall and the second sidewall define a front end and a rear end of the intake housing. 
     
     
         19 . The snowthrower of  claim 18 , wherein a front-rear distance from the bottom edge to the rear end is longer than a front-rear distance from the center of gravity to the rear end. 
     
     
         20 . The snowthrower of  claim 18 , wherein a front-rear distance from the bottom edge to the front end is shorter than a front-rear distance from the center of gravity to the front end.
